Mid-term Grading
MID-TERM LIMITED GRADE PROCESSING
Midterm Grade Rosters are produced for these students: FIRST YEARS, NEW TRANSFERS, and READMITS for the current term (1082) as well as the preceding fall term (1077).
Review your roster.
IF YOU HAVE STUDENTS WHO HAVE DEFICIENT GRADES:
- Enter one of the following grades: C-, D+, D, D-, F, FA (Failure due to attendance), or FT (Failure due to tests).
- You are no longer able to enter grades for students who are making a grade of A, B, or C because it is not necessary to enter a grade for these students.
- If there is a “W” grade showing in the “OFFICIAL GRADE” column, the course has been dropped and you do not have to enter a grade for this student.
- After you enter the grades, click SAVE, and EXIT the roster.
NOTE: The “Approval Status” box is now grayed out because it is not a part of the Mid-Term Grading Process.
IF YOU DO NOT HAVE STUDENTS ON YOUR ROSTER MAKING A C- OR BELOW:
- Look for the checkbox labeled “Roster Reviewed, No Deficiencies”, CHECK IT, Click SAVE, and EXIT the roster.

FAQ’s:
Q. I don’t have a grade roster. Why?
A. You have no students in your class that are FY, New Transfers, or New Readmits.
Q. Why won’t it let me “Approve” my roster?
A. You do not have to “Approve” your Midterm Grade Roster, only SAVE and Exit the
Roster. The “Approval Status” box is uniquely used only for End-of-Term Grading.
Q. Should I enter grades for everyone on my roster, even the ones that are doing well?
A. No. Only enter grades for students who are making a C- or below (including FA –
Failure due to attendance, or FT – Failure due to tests).
Q. When I look back at roster, it looks the same. Did I do it right?
A. Yes, the roster will still look the same, but when you SAVE and exit, it is finished.
